Desert Cacti
Desert cacti are iconic inhabitants of arid regions, renowned for their remarkable adaptations to extreme conditions. With thick, succulent stems to store water, needle-like spines for protection, and shallow root systems to capture rainfall, they thrive in desolate landscapes.
